Dhahran, Eastern Province · Information Technology
Web Method Developer
Responsibilities:
Scope & Impact - Independently responsible for the entire lifecycle of projects including design, development, and deployment
Technical Execution - Write clean code, improve code structure and design in service of testability and maintainability, write and review design documentation, be highly proficient in one or more technical areas
Ownership - Responsible for substantial part of the codebase; serve as on-call first responder for services the team owns; prioritize and value unowned or undesirable work that enables the team to move faster
Collaboration - Work with the team and adjacent teams to solve problems, escalate problems that have a wider scope
Team Building - Perform code reviews; assist and teach other developers on an individual basis; participate in the hiring process, conduct interviews
Must Have:
Experience in webMethods 10.x and higher versions.
Strong knowledge on REST and SOAP web services, pub-sub using JMS and UM queues, file based interfaces, etc
Strong capabilities in B2B interfaces and in using webmethods TN component.
Experience working with webMethods UM and messaging platforms
Skilled in Webmethods administration activities and basic unix skills
Experience in Agile projects
Knowledge/experience of using webmethods as containers and creating docker images, etc.
Skilled at using wM API Gateway product and applying policies and managing APIs
Experience with Azure/AWS platform especially with integration components